Hi all,
has anyone successfully set-up incremental refresh using Amazon Redshift as a data source?
We tried setting it up using the data connector for Redshift as well as an ODBC connection. In both instances query folding did not occur after applying the RangeStart and RangeEnd parameters as filters to the date column.
I will really appreciate if someone can help with this issue. Essentially, I am trying to upload a small data into service and run a refresh in service to pull 3 years of data and incrmental thereafter. When I apply the filter and run my query, which when sent to redshift does not recogive the data parameters passed:
